Table 1-2. Product Comparisons

Processor*

Memory

Display

Video

Operating System

Desktop

Management

Interface

OmniBook 6000

Celeron (550 MHz) or Pentium

III(600/500, 650/500, or 700/600 MHz).

64 or 128 MB SDRAM in system slot. Expandable to 512 MB.

15.0- or 14.1-inch TFT XGA display.

AGP graphics interface.

4 or 8 MB video RAM with 32- or 64-bit graphics interface and 64-bit graphics controller. 3D and OpenGL graphics support.

Up to 16M colors (XGA). Zoomed Video enabled.

Windows 95, Windows 98, or

Windows 2000 preinstalled.

DMI 2.3.

HP TopTools 4.5.

OmniBook 4150B

Celeron (450 MHz), Pentium II (366 to 500 MHz), or Pentium III (650/500 MHz).

64 MB SDRAM. Expandable to 256 or 512 MB.

14.1- or 13.3-inch TFT XGA display.

AGP graphics interface.

4 or 8 MB video RAM with 32- or 64-bit graphics interface and 64-bit graphics controller. 3D and OpenGL graphics support.

Up to 16M colors (XGA). Zoomed Video enabled.

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ows NT, or Windows 2000 preinstalled.

DMI 2.0.

HP TopTools 2.6 to 4.5.

OmniBook 900B

Pentium III (450, 500, 600/500, or 650/500 MHz).

64 MB SDRAM on motherboard. Expandable to 160 or 320 MB.

13.3-inch TFT XGA or 12.1- inch TFT SVGA display.

AGP graphics interface.

4MB video RAM with 32-bit graphics interface and 64-bit graphics controller.

3D and OpenGL graphics support.

Up to 16M colors (XGA). Zoomed Video enabled.

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ows NT, or Windows 2000 preinstalled.

DMI 2.0.

HP TopTools 3.0 to 4.5.

Power Management

Power States

APM 1.2.

ACPI compliant.

On, Display-off, Standby, Hibernate, Off.

APM 1.2.

ACPI compliant.

On, Display-off, Standby, Hibernate, Off.

APM 1.2.

ACPI compliant.

On, Display-off, Standby, Hibernate, Off.

* Intel Mobile Pentium or Mobile Celeron Processor. Dual-speed processors use Intel SpeedStep Technology.
